Bug 251348

Summary: www/tomcat7: Update to 7.0.107, add support of java 9+ in rc.d script, add support of umask
Product: Ports & Packages Reporter: VVD <vvd>
Component: Individual Port(s)Assignee: Alex Dupre <ale>
Status: Closed FIXED    
Severity: Affects Only Me Flags: bugzilla: maintainer-feedback? (ale)
Priority: ---    
Version: Latest   
Hardware: Any   
OS: Any   
URL: https://tomcat.apache.org/tomcat-7.0-doc/changelog.html#Tomcat_7.0.107_(violetagg)
Attachments:
Description Flags
Update to 7.0.107, add support of java 9+ in rc.d script, add support of umask vvd: maintainer-approval?

Description VVD 2020-11-24 18:25:12 UTC
Created attachment 219935 [details]
Update to 7.0.107, add support of java 9+ in rc.d script, add support of umask

Tested on 12.1 amd64: build/check-plist/run.
Comment 1 Alex Dupre freebsd_committer 2020-11-25 08:29:55 UTC
The change to umask 0077 as default seems a bit aggressive, what do you think to relax the default to 0027?
Comment 2 VVD 2020-11-25 13:13:03 UTC
(In reply to Alex Dupre from comment #1)
We have default 0077 for other tomcat ports.
But if you want, you can replace it with 0027 for tomcat7.
Comment 3 commit-hook freebsd_committer 2020-11-25 13:24:17 UTC
A commit references this bug:

Author: ale
Date: Wed Nov 25 13:23:37 UTC 2020
New revision: 556291
URL: https://svnweb.freebsd.org/changeset/ports/556291

Log:
  - Update to 7.0.107 release
  - Add support for java 9+ in rc.d script
  - Add support for setting a different umask (077 by default)

  PR:		251348
  Submitted by:	VVD <vvd@unislabs.com>

Changes:
  head/www/tomcat7/Makefile
  head/www/tomcat7/distinfo
  head/www/tomcat7/files/tomcat7.in
  head/www/tomcat7/pkg-plist